Michael Jackson (1958-2009)

You had Sinatra in the 40s, Elvis in the 50s, The Beatles in the 60s, and in the 80s and 90s you had Michael Jackson. The King of Pop, Michael Jackson may very well be the greatest entertainer of our lifetime. Entering the limelight in 1964, at the age of 6, Michael entertained millions from every corner of the globe for half a century. His contributions to pop culture and society are endless, ranging from changing the world of music and dance to starting the Heal the World Foundation. His album Thriller remains the most popular album in the world, having sold over 750,000,000 copies.

Not just an entertainer, Michael was a passionate humanitarian, and he often expressed his passion in his lyrics. In songs like “We are the World” and “Main in the Mirror” Michael spoke to the hearts of people and made powerful statements of the need for unity, compassion, and peace among mankind. He founded the ‘Heal the World Foundation’ in 1992, through which he airlifted 46 tons of supplies to Sarajevo and donated millions of dollars to beneficial causes, released charity singles and supported 39 other charities. In 2000 he was cited with the world record for “Most Charities Supported by a Pop Star.”
